PLEASE, NO LINKS OR FILES. If the diameter of a cylinder is 6 yards, then the value of r 2 is 9 square yards. True False

Answer:

True.

Step-by-step explanation:

R² is radius to the second power. You were given the diameter, so the radius will be half of that diameter.

3 to the second power, (or 3 x3), is 9.
